Nancy is a Senior Faculty at the San Diego campus of the Center for Creative Leadership. She facilitates open enrollment programs as well as designs and delivers customized solutions for market-leading companies operating the US and globally. Prior to joining CCL in 1994, Nancy was a Commissioned Officer in the United States Navy. As Director of the Mental Health Unit at the Naval Training Center San Diego, she was responsible for overseeing services to a group of 20,000 active duty personnel. Her military service provided first-hand experience of working within organizational hierarchy and politics as well as proficiency in teamwork and crossfunctional collaboration. Following the military, Nancy co-founded Applied Psychometrics, a consulting firm with a specialization in assessment for selection and development. In addition she has worked as a sports psychologist, assisting athletes and teams to maximize their talents for optimal performance. In conjunction with the Stanford Graduate School of Business, she designed and delivered a creative Golf & Leadership workshop.

Nancy brings over 25 years of diverse experience in people development to her work at CCL. Her career focus is understanding human behavior and she leverages that knowledge to enable individuals and teams to discover new possibilities and solutions to organizational challenges. Her expertise is coaching senior leaders and C-suite executives. Nancy quickly establishes trust with clients and helps them to grow bigger minds to deal with the ever-increasing complexity and volatility in today’s business world.

Current Role

In addition to custom design and delivery, Nancy is a lead faculty for CCL’s flagship program, the Leadership Development Program, and for Leading for Organizational Impact, a feedback-rich simulation for leaders who are responsible for organizational functions, divisions or business units. She is certified in many psychometric and 360-degree instruments that can yield useful perspectives in these explorations. Her clients have crossed multiple industries including finance, manufacturing, biotechnology and pharmaceutical science, hospitality, consumer goods and governmental agencies. She consistently helps leaders to find practical ways of sustaining existing business with limited resources and regulatory standards while simultaneiously driving growth for the future.

Educational Background

Nancy received a B.A. in psychology from the University of Connecticut, a Masters from Loyola Marymount University, and a Ph.D. from Alliant International University. She holds a California Psychology License and she is a Board Certified Coach (BCC) through the Center for Credentialing and Education.

Professional Affiliations

Nancy is a member of the Society for Consulting Psychology, the Society for Industrial and Organizational Psychology, and several professional associations for which she has served in Board positions including President.
